1. The Seated Cat-Cow Stretch
This classic yoga pose is adapted for your chair. It helps to warm up the spine and relieve tension in your back and neck.
- Sit on the edge of your chair with your feet flat on the floor.
- Cow Pose: Inhale as you arch your back, push your chest forward, and look up.
- Cat Pose: Exhale as you round your spine, tuck your chin to your chest, and let your shoulders and head come forward.
- Repeat 5-10 times.
2. Seated Spinal Twist

- Sit tall in your chair with both feet on the floor.
- Exhale and twist your torso to the right, using your hands to gently deepen the stretch by holding onto the back or arm of the chair.
- Hold for 20-30 seconds, breathing deeply.
- Repeat on the left side.
3. Hamstring Stretch
Tight hamstrings can pull on your lower back, contributing to pain. This is a common issue we see in our Noida home-visit patients.
- Sit on the edge of your chair and straighten one leg out in front of you, with your heel on the floor.
- Keeping your back straight, gently lean forward until you feel a stretch in the back of your leg.
- Hold for 20-30 seconds and switch legs.
4. Neck and Shoulder Release

- Sit up straight and gently tilt your right ear toward your right shoulder. Do not force it.
- To deepen the stretch, you can gently place your right hand on your head.
- Hold for 15-20 seconds. Repeat on the other side.
- Follow up with gentle shoulder rolls, backwards and forwards.
5. Glute Stretch (Seated Pigeon Pose)
Your gluteal muscles can get tight from sitting, which can lead to lower back pain and even sciatica. This is the #1 stretch for glute relief.
- While seated, cross your right ankle over your left knee.
- If you feel a good stretch here, hold it. To deepen, gently lean forward while keeping your back straight.
- Hold for 20-30 seconds, then switch sides.
